Default oil pan change

I changed the oil pan on my LQ9 engine in a 1956 chevy. I put in a Holly pan to get more ground clearance, the pan was the lowest part of the car. I'm about to start the engine.
Will the oil pump suck up the oil from the pan or do I have to pressurize the engine and then start it?

its certainly always best to prime the engine with oil before starting it for the first time or after along time. if you cant atleast make sure the oil filter is full and turn it over for a bit with the fuel injectors and coils unplugged.
